Nate Williams 1285c95c4b Because 'ipfw flush' is such a dangerous command (given that most
firewalls are remote, and this command will kill the network connection
to them), prompt the user for confirmation of this command.

Also, add the '-f' flag which ignores the need for confirmation the
command, and if there is no controlling tty (isatty(STDIN_FILENO) !=0)
assume '-f'.

If anyone is using ipfw flush in scripts it shouldn't affect them, but you
may want to change the script to use a 'ipfw -f flush'.

Paul Traina 978eb210d1 Completely rewrite handling of protocol field for firewalls, things are
now completely consistent across all IP protocols and should be quite a
bit faster.

Use getprotoname() extensively, performed minor cleanups of admin utility.
The admin utility could use a good kick in the pants.

Basicly, these were the minimal changes I could make to the code
to get it up to tollerable shape.  There will be some future commits
to clean up the basic architecture of the firewall code, and if
I'm feeling ambitious, I may pull in changes like NAT from Linux
and make the firewall hooks comletely generic so that a user can
either load the ipfw module or the ipfilter module (cf Darren Reed).
